In the new FourFourTwo â out now, folks â we profile the work of Middlesbrough fan and artist Steve Welsh. A former cartoonist for iconic fanzine Fly Me To The Moon, Welsh set up MiniBoro.com to collate interviews but also to showcase his art. And we should all be glad.

Far from being Boro-centric, the site celebrates cult heroes from around the world and across the decades. Welsh's often simple yet brilliantly executed images tend to concentrate on a well-known aspect of a player or team and play with the visual iconography â so Stuart Pearce is celebrated with an image of the blood circling out of the shower in Hitchcock's Psycho, while Edgar Davids is represented as a pitbull with the simple byelaw-quoting 'no fouling'.
